Software testing courses can help you learn test planning, test case design, automated testing, and performance testing. You can build skills in identifying bugs, writing effective test scripts, and using various testing methodologies. Many courses introduce tools like Selenium for automation, JUnit for unit testing, and JIRA for issue tracking, showing how these skills apply in real-world software development environments.

Packt
Skills you'll gain: Node.JS, File I/O, Javascript, Event-Driven Programming, Web Applications, Web Servers, Software Installation, Server Side, Application Development, JSON, Real Time Data, Command-Line Interface, TCP/IP, OS Process Management
Intermediate · Course · 1 - 3 Months

Skills you'll gain: CI/CD, Continuous Integration, Jenkins, Continuous Deployment, Devops Tools, Software Configuration Management, User Accounts, Application Programming Interface (API), Authorization (Computing)
Intermediate · Guided Project · Less Than 2 Hours

Microsoft
Skills you'll gain: Data Wrangling, Data Manipulation, Data Transformation, Tidyverse (R Package), Data Cleansing, Data Preprocessing, R Programming, Data Structures
Beginner · Course · 1 - 4 Weeks
Google Cloud
Skills you'll gain: Calendar Management, Google Workspace, Setting Appointments, Organizational Skills, Scheduling, Collaborative Software, Event Management, Data Sharing
Beginner · Course · 1 - 3 Months

Skills you'll gain: Business Planning, Process Flow Diagrams, Diagram Design, Business Strategy, Strategic Thinking, Strategic Planning, User Accounts, Productivity Software, Collaborative Software, Graphic Design, Market Analysis
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Information Technology Operations, Disaster Recovery, Document Management, Incident Response, Computer Security Incident Management, Information Technology, Change Control, Safety and Security, Technical Communication, Linux, Microsoft Windows, Personally Identifiable Information, Remote Access Systems, Scripting, Bash (Scripting Language), Artificial Intelligence, Windows PowerShell, Software Installation
Intermediate ·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: NSX-T Network Virtualization, Software-Defined Networking, Zero Trust Network Access, Virtual Networking, Virtual Local Area Network (VLAN), Network Switches, Network Architecture, Network Routing, Network Security, Security Controls, Firewall, Scalability
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Docker (Software), CI/CD, Model Deployment, Cloud Deployment, Cloud Development, Application Performance Management, Google App Engine
Intermediate · Course · 1 - 3 Months
Google Cloud
Skills you'll gain: Google Sheets, Data Validation, Excel Formulas, Spreadsheet Software, Excel Macros, Data Visualization, Google Workspace, Business Solutions, Data Analysis Expressions (DAX), Data Integrity, Data Cleansing, Productivity Software, Data Import/Export
Intermediate · Course · 1 - 3 Months
Skills you'll gain: Microsoft Power Automate/Flow, Microsoft Power Platform, Microsoft 365, Data Integration, Digital Transformation, React.js, Frontend Performance, Business Process Automation, Web Development Tools, Automation, Process Optimization, Application Programming Interface (API), Data Transformation, Integration Testing, Development Testing
Intermediate · Course · 1 - 4 Weeks

Skills you'll gain: Animations, Figma (Design Software), Photo Editing, User Accounts, Social Media Marketing
Beginner · Guided Project · Less Than 2 Hours

Skills you'll gain: Virtualization and Virtual Machines, Network Administration, File Systems
Intermediate · Course · 1 - 3 Months